Смарт-контракты на Cardano — это мощный инструмент, который открывает разработчикам новые горизонты для создания децентрализованных приложений (dApps). С запуском поддержки смарт-контрактов в 2021 году через обновление Alonzo платформа предоставила языки программирования, такие как Plutus и Marlowe, обеспечивающие безопасность, точность и гибкость. Для российской аудитории, где IT-сектор активно развивается, Cardano предлагает уникальную среду для создания приложений в сферах финансов, игр, образования и не только, с минимальными затратами благодаря низким комиссиям сети.
Cardano выделяется своим научным подходом к разработке смарт-контрактов. Все решения проходят академическую проверку, что снижает риск ошибок и уязвимостей — критически важный аспект для разработчиков. Экологичный протокол Ouroboros и многослойная архитектура делают платформу не только надёжной, но и масштабируемой, позволяя создавать приложения, способные обслуживать миллионы пользователей. Эта статья расскажет, как смарт-контракты Cardano помогают разработчикам воплощать идеи в жизнь и почему они становятся выбором номер один в 2025 году.
Почему Cardano привлекает разработчиков
Смарт-контракты на Cardano созданы с учётом потребностей разработчиков, предлагая баланс между сложностью и доступностью. Платформа использует язык Plutus, основанный на Haskell, который обеспечивает формальную верификацию кода, гарантируя его корректность. Это делает Cardano особенно привлекательной для российских разработчиков, которые работают над сложными проектами, требующими высокой надёжности, такими как финансовые системы или медицинские приложения.
Вот ключевые преимущества смарт-контрактов на Cardano:
- Безопасность: Формальная верификация минимизирует ошибки в коде.
- Гибкость: Plutus поддерживает сложные логики, а Marlowe — простые контракты для новичков.
- Низкие комиссии: Транзакции стоят менее 1 рубля, что экономит ресурсы.
- Масштабируемость: Многослойная архитектура позволяет обрабатывать тысячи операций.
- Экологичность: Ouroboros потребляет минимум энергии, поддерживая зелёные технологии.
Эти особенности делают Cardano идеальной платформой для разработчиков, стремящихся создавать инновационные решения. В России, где спрос на блокчейн-разработчиков растёт, Cardano предлагает конкурентное преимущество благодаря своей технологической глубине и доступности.
Технические возможности для создания dApps
Язык Plutus — основа смарт-контрактов на Cardano, позволяющий разрабатывать приложения с высокой степенью контроля. Он использует функциональное программирование, что упрощает написание сложных контрактов, таких как DeFi-протоколы или системы голосования. Для российских IT-специалистов, знакомых с Haskell или другими функциональными языками, освоение Plutus становится естественным шагом, открывающим двери в экосистему Cardano.
Параметр | Plutus (Cardano) | Solidity (Ethereum) | Rust (Solana) |
---|---|---|---|
Основной язык | Haskell | JavaScript-подобный | Rust |
Тип верификации | Формальная | Тестирование | Тестирование |
Сложность освоения | Средняя–высокая | Низкая–средняя | Средняя |
Экосистема dApps | DeFi, NFT, идентичность | DeFi, NFT, игры | DeFi, высокоскоростные приложения |
Сообщество | Растущее (~10,000 разработчиков) | Крупное (~100,000 разработчиков) | Среднее (~20,000 разработчиков) |
Для тех, кто не имеет опыта программирования, Cardano предлагает Marlowe — язык, предназначенный для создания финансовых контрактов без глубоких технических знаний. Например, российский стартап может использовать Marlowe для автоматизации договоров с поставщиками, задав условия в визуальном редакторе. Это снижает барьеры входа и делает Cardano доступной для предпринимателей, желающих внедрить блокчейн в свой бизнес.
Ещё одно преимущество — интеграция с инструментами разработки, такими как Plutus Application Backend (PAB). PAB упрощает взаимодействие смарт-контрактов с внешними данными, позволяя создавать приложения, которые, например, реагируют на рыночные цены или пользовательские действия. Для России, где IT-рынок ориентирован на глобальные проекты, такие возможности делают Cardano платформой для конкурентоспособных решений.
Реальные применения смарт-контрактов
Смарт-контракты на Cardano находят применение в самых разных областях, от финансов до образования. DeFi-протоколы, такие как Minswap или WingRiders, используют Plutus для создания платформ обмена и кредитования, привлекая миллионы долларов в 2025 году. Для российских разработчиков это шанс участвовать в глобальной экономике, создавая приложения, которые конкурируют с мировыми лидерами.
- DeFi: Платформы для кредитов, стейкинга и обмена токенов.
- NFT: Смарт-контракты для выпуска и торговли цифровыми активами.
- Образование: Сертификация дипломов и курсов на блокчейне.
- Голосование: Прозрачные системы для сообществ и организаций.
- Логистика: Автоматизация цепочек поставок с помощью контрактов.
Для российских разработчиков эти направления — шанс выделиться. Представьте платформу, где фрилансеры из Москвы получают оплату через смарт-контракт, который гарантирует выполнение условий. Это исключает споры и задержки, что особенно актуально в условиях глобального рынка труда.
NFT на Cardano — ещё одно поле для творчества. Смарт-контракты позволяют выпускать токены за копейки, что привлекает российских художников и музыкантов. Платформы вроде CNFT.io становятся хабами для креативных индустрий, где разработчики создают инструменты для торговли и коллекционирования. Это не только про деньги, но и про построение сообщества вокруг искусства.
Будущее смарт-контрактов на Cardano связано с масштабированием. Обновление Hydra, запланированное на 2025–2026 годы, позволит запускать тысячи контрактов одновременно, сохраняя низкие комиссии. Для российских стартапов это означает, что их приложения смогут обслуживать миллионы пользователей, конкурируя с глобальными гигантами.
Cardano для российских разработчиков
Для России Cardano — это не просто платформа, а экосистема возможностей. IT-специалисты могут участвовать в хакатонах, таких как Cardano Summit, получая гранты за лучшие идеи. Это особенно актуально для молодых разработчиков, которые хотят заявить о себе на международной арене.
Сообщество Cardano активно поддерживает новичков. Telegram-каналы, такие как @CardanoDevRussia, предлагают туториалы, обсуждения и помощь в освоении Plutus. Это снижает барьеры входа, позволяя даже тем, кто не знает Haskell, начать с Marlowe и постепенно углубляться.
Наконец, Cardano открывает доступ к глобальному рынку. Российский разработчик может создать dApp для африканского рынка, используя смарт-контракты для микрофинансирования. Это не только приносит доход, но и укрепляет репутацию России как центра блокчейн-инноваций.